Research Communication: Real-World Clinical Experience With Seladelpar in Primary Biliary Cholangitis
Selena Z Kuo1,2, Jeffrey Yin3, Rohit Loomba1,2
1NAFLD Research Center, Division of Gastroenterology, University of California at San Diego, La Jolla, California, USA.
Abstract:
Seladelpar recently received accelerated FDA approval for the treatment of primary biliary cholangitis (PBC) but there is limited knowledge regarding its efficacy in real-world clinical practice. This is a study of a cohort of adults with PBC who were started on seladelpar as second-line therapy between October 2024 and March 2025. Of the 18 patients, 11 were trialed on a second-line therapy prior to switching to seladelpar, whereas 7 of the patients started seladelpar as initial second-line therapy. Biochemical response was achieved in 56.3% of patients and normalisation of alkaline phosphatase levels in 31.3% of patients after 1 month of treatment. This study demonstrates the efficacy of seladelpar as a second-line agent in a real-world clinical setting.
